General RV is preparing to return to the 2024 Florida RV SuperShow at the Florida State Fairgrounds in Tampa. The Florida RV Trade Association (FRVTA) will host the 39th Annual SuperShow January 16-21. Considered the official start of the RV show season in the U.S., the Florida RV SuperShow will feature thousands of RVs from every major manufacturer, as well as hundreds of accessory exhibitors.

The theme of the 2024 Florida RV SuperShow is “Rock on Down the Highway!” With thousands of RVs on display and educational seminars, the SuperShow is the perfect place to trade-in your old RV or get acquainted with the RV lifestyle. Some of Florida’s finest campgrounds and RV resorts will also have exhibits to show guests the best camping opportunities around. Furthermore, you’ll also find a huge display of camping accessories and supplies in the General RV Store.

What to Know Before You Go to the Florida RV SuperShow

Admission to the Florida RV SuperShow is $15 for adults and that includes a second day admission for the cost of one day. Children under the age of 16 are free. The Florida RV SuperShow hours are Wednesday, January 17, through Saturday, January 21, 9 a.m. to 6 p.m. and Sunday 9 a.m. to 5 p.m.  Wednesday-Friday are Senior Citizens Days with seniors receiving $2 off the cost of admission (not valid with other discounts).

RV Industry Day will be Tuesday, January 16, from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. Anyone involved in the RV industry is welcome to attend this day for free. Complimentary coffee and donuts will be served in the morning with a free lunch also provided.

A favorite of all visitors to the Florida RV SuperShow is the free entertainment. From clowns and unicycle riders to Barbershop Quartets and Bagpipe bands, the Florida RV SuperShow has enough entertainment to keep everyone busy the entire day. Also, take advantage of the free shuttle service inside the SuperShow that will transport guests from exhibit to exhibit.

Brinkley Model Z 3400 Fifth Wheel

Brinkley RV Model Z 3400 fifth wheel floorplan

The all-new Brinkley Model Z 3400 mid-sized luxury fifth wheel is in a class of its own, featuring an automotive exterior with a residential interior. Whether you’re a weekend camper or a full-time RVer, the Model Z offers features and amenities that will appeal to all camping enthusiasts. Those features include Brinkley CraftSense wood trim construction, an 84” pantry with adjustable shelves, flush floor slides, a class-leading 79.5″ bed and bath interior height, to name a few.

The new Model Z 3400 is an entertainer’s dream with the Zero-Gravity rear patio and outdoor kitchen/workspace including a large refrigerator, 50” Smart TV on a swivel mount, cabinet storage, bar sink and work surface. The rear patio space doubles as storage, including an E-Z Load rear cargo access door. With more than 24 outlets, including six outlets with USB/USB-C, there is no shortage of space to entertain and relax.

Brinkley Model Z Air 295 Travel Trailer

Brinkley RV Model Z Air 295 floorplan

Discover the pinnacle of luxury with Brinkley RV’s first travel trailer, the Model Z Air 295. This bunk house travel trailer is loaded with amenities, making it feel more like a fifth wheel. Among those amenities is the seven-foot-tall sidewalls and barreled ceiling to provide a more open atmosphere. Enjoy the convenience of the eat-in kitchen island with included bar stools. The island also features plenty of drawers and cabinets with designated space for two trash cans.

The Furrion Chill Cube air conditioner provides 18,000 BTU of efficient cooling power. This allows you to run both this unit and the second A/C in the bedroom on just 30-amp service. The bunk room is tucked behind folding doors that features double-over-double bunks and a wardrobe with drawers. The bedroom features a queen bed with a padded headboard. The taller ceiling height also translates into additional cabinet height. With about 2,400 pounds of cargo capacity, the Model Z Air offers industry-leading storage space for all of your gear.

Heartland RV Corterra Fifth Wheels

Heartland RV Corterra fifth wheel

Heartland RV has unveiled a new mid-tier line of fifth wheels and travel trailers, Corterra, boasting a spacious and open-concept interior, featuring top-of-the-line materials and sleek, contemporary design elements. From the Latin ‘cor’ for heart, and ‘terra’ for land, Corterra embodies the best of humanity and nature.

Corterra is built around a 10-inch I-beam frame, giving it a solid but lightweight foundation on the road. An innovative, new aerodynamic front cap includes an expansive windshield that offers stunning views of nature. Inside Corterra, residential amenities make the space comfortable. The kitchen includes an illuminated wine or coffee bar, and there’s a pull-out trash can with a hidden storage drawer. A residential appliance package includes a 30-inch, over-the-range microwave and a 16-cubic-foot refrigerator to make cooking all of your favorite meals on the road simple and convenient. A hidden pantry sits behind the entertainment center, which also offers additional storage space in the mantel.

In the bedroom, there’s a residential king bed, plus dual wardrobes and ample dresser storage. Every Corterra model also comes standard with washer and dryer prep. Features like built-in pet bowls, hidden storage in the stairs and dinette seating, sleek hardware-free drawers and cabinets, and flush floor slides set Heartland’s newest model apart from the competition.

Coachmen RV Euro Class A Motorhome

Coachmen RV Euro Class A motorhome

The all-new Euro Class A motorhome from Coachmen RV provides the compactness, look and features of a European motorhome with North American creature comforts. The Euro is shorter, more compact and narrow than a traditional Class A.

Built atop the Ford F53 chassis with a 178-inch wheelbase and the 7.3 V8 gas-powered engine, the Euro stands out not only because of its European styling but also because of its short stature. The Euro is only 27 feet, 6 inches long, 11 feet tall and 99 inches wide. Inside, the 50-amp Euro offers square windows, European curved cabinetry and a pair of GE Profile AC units.

The Euro comes equipped with a host of automotive features, making it feel and drive more like a large SUV than a Class A motorhome. The onboard 5.5 kW gas generator and 300W solar panel with controller will help stretch those long trips even further.
